Video highlights Christina River sampling effort by DNREC

A new DNREC video highlights the WATAR program and the sampling program in the Christina River to identify toxins and lead efforts for watershed restoration. The Watershed Approach to Toxics Assessment and Restoration (WATAR) is a watershed-scale approach to the evaluation of contaminant sources, transport pathways and receptors. WATAR combines the efforts and expertise of …
